A well-repaired chimney should last for many years, and part of good chimney repair is doing the work in a way that secures that longevity rather than simply getting through the next winter. Durability comes from addressing the cause of a fault rather than its symptom: repointing weathered joints with a mortar matched to the brick and finished to shed water, replacing perished bricks and relaying loose courses properly, renewing flaunching so the pots stay bedded and sealed, and rebuilding the upper stack where decay has gone too far for less. Each of these, done correctly, restores a part of the chimney’s defence against the weather, and together they return the whole stack to a watertight, stable condition that should not need revisiting for a long time. The opposite approach, a quick smear of mortar over a failing joint or a patch of fresh flaunching laid over a cracked one, may look fine briefly but fails again within a season, costing more in the end. There is value, too, in catching faults early, while they are still small, since a chimney attended to promptly needs far less work than one left until the damage has spread. Signs You Need Chimney Repair

The signs that a chimney needs repair arrive in stages, and knowing how they progress from the first faint hint to an unmistakable problem is the key to acting at the right moment. In the earliest stage the clues are easy to miss: a little mortar dust or grit appearing in the hearth, a faint musty smell on damp days, or pointing that has just begun to look weathered and recessed when seen up close. At this point the stack is still fundamentally sound and a modest repair will keep it that way. Left unattended, the signs grow more definite. Damp patches start to show on the chimney breast and spread; paint blisters and decoration lifts; brick faces begin to flake as frost works on saturated masonry; and the flaunching at the top cracks, loosening the pots. Later still come the serious indicators that should never be ignored: a pot tilting or shedding its cowl, whole bricks loose or missing, white efflorescence blooming across the masonry, and, most gravely, a stack that has begun to lean or a crack stepping through the brickwork. In Halstead’s homes a chimney can be found at any point along this progression. The lesson is consistent throughout: the earlier in the sequence the trouble is caught, the smaller and cheaper the remedy, because every stage that passes lets water reach further into the structure. A faint smell or a little grit in the grate is not nothing; it is the start of a process that ends, if ignored, in a rebuild. Reading the signs as a progression, and acting early, is what keeps a repair small.

Emergency Chimney Repairs Halstead

Handling a chimney emergency well is less about haste than about a calm, methodical approach, working through the right steps in the right order so that the urgent danger is removed without anything being made worse. The first step is to assess the situation from a safe position, judging what has happened, what is unstable and what risk it poses to people and property below, rather than rushing up to a stack that may be more fragile than it looks. The second is to isolate the danger, keeping everyone clear of the ground beneath the chimney where masonry might fall. The third is to make safe, securing or carefully bringing down whatever is loose and sealing the opened top against the weather. Only with those done does the fourth step follow: planning the lasting repair or rebuild, carried out properly with the right materials and at a sensible pace. Repointing involves raking out the old, perished mortar between the bricks and replacing it with fresh, professional-grade pointing. It matters because failed mortar lets water seep into the brickwork, which can cause internal damp, plaster damage, and frost damage that weakens the entire stack over time.

Flashing is the lead detailing that seals the junction where the chimney meets the roof, and it’s one of the most common leak points on any property. It should be replaced when the lead cracks, lifts, or corrodes, as a worn seal will let water track into the roof and down into your home.

Both protect the top of the flue, but a cap typically seals or covers an unused chimney while still allowing ventilation, whereas a cowl sits over an active flue to improve draught and keep out rain and birds. We can advise which is right depending on whether your chimney is still in use.

A cowl stops birds nesting in the flue and prevents rain entering an unused chimney, while still maintaining the essential airflow that keeps the stack dry. This protects your home from blockages, moisture build-up, and the damp problems that come from a sealed but unventilated flue.
Yes. A neglected chimney is a frequent source of damp penetration, leading to internal plaster damage and staining on ceilings and walls. The cause is usually perished mortar or failed flashing, both of which we can identify and repair to restore a weather-tight seal.

Why chimney damage happens

Chimneys are constantly exposed to the elements. Rain, wind, frost, and even heat from inside the home all play a part in gradual wear and tear. Over time, this can lead to crumbling mortar, damaged bricks, and weakened joints. In many cases, what starts as a small issue eventually turns into something more serious if no chimney repair services are carried out.

Chimney tops, crowns, and caps

The top section of a chimney is one of the most exposed areas, which means it often shows damage first. A cracked or worn crown is a common problem, often needing chimney crown repair, cracked chimney crown repair, or in more severe cases, a full chimney crown replacement.

Chimney caps also play an important role in keeping out rain and debris. If they fail, water can quickly enter the flue system, leading to internal damage. That’s when services like chimney cap repair, chimney cap replacement, or chimney cap leak repair are required to stop chimney leaks before they spread further.

Waterproofing and moisture protection

Moisture is one of the biggest threats to chimney health. Once it gets into the masonry, it can spread quickly and cause long-term damage. That’s why many property owners opt for chimney waterproofing as a preventative measure.

Applying a chimney waterproof sealant helps reduce water absorption while still allowing the brickwork to breathe. In cases where damage has already occurred, chimney water damage repair or chimney moisture repair may be required before sealing can be effective.
